S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S
Important: This appliance is not intended for use by persons including children with reduced physical, sensory or
mental capabilities, or lack of experience and knowledge, unless they have been given supervision or instruction
concerning use of the appliance by a person responsible for their safety.
• Please read all instructions carefully before using the radiator for the first time.
• Before plugging in the radiator, check if the voltage indicated on the rating label corresponds with the main
voltage in your home.
• Do not immerse the radiator or cord in water or any other liquid. Do not use it in a bathroom, near water, or
outdoors.
• When the radiator is turned on for the rst time, operate it at maximum for at least 2 hours. During this time,
make sure you are in a well ventilated area while the “new smell” is burned o. This is completely normal and
not a cause for concern.
• It is normal for the radiator to make “cracking” noises when it is heating up and cooling down.
• Do not use the radiator for anything other than its intended use.
• Never leave the radiator unattended whilst in use.
• Do not pull on the cord to disconnect the plug from the wall socket.
• Do not use the radiator to dry washing.
• Do not use the radiator if the power cord or plug is damaged. Do not replace the power cord or any other parts
yourself.
• Never rest the power cable on the hot fins of the radiator.
• Always ensure that the radiator is positioned at least 50cm away from furniture or other objects.
• The radiator should not be used if it has been dropped or if there are visible signs of damage.
• This radiator is for household indoor use only. Never use it outdoors.
• Never use the radiator on its side, it must always be used upright.
• Children should not be allowed to play with the radiator.
• Before moving or attempting to clean the radiator, allow it to cool down completely.
• The radiator should not be placed directly under a fixed power socket.
• The radiator is lled with a precise quantity of oil and repairs requiring it to be opened must be carried out by the
manufacturer. If the radiator leaks, contact the manufacturer.
• This product contains oil and must be disposed of correctly. Do not dispose with general household waste. Take
it to your nearest waste management center for processing.
• The use of an extension lead is not recommended, as overheating of the extension lead may occur during the
operation of the radiator.
• The radiator should never be switch on through an external timer or any kind of separate remote control system.

Operating Instructions
IMPORTANT
When the radiator is in use, it should always be
kept vertical (handle should be at the top). Putting
the radiator in any other position could be
dangerous and cause a potential re hazard.
Using your Radiator for the First Time
• When the radiator is turned on for the rst time, operate at its maximum heat setting for at least two hours.
Ensure you are in a well ventilated area during this time as the heater will give o a “new” smell. This is
completely normal.
• The radiator will make cracking noises when it is rst turned on and when it is turned o and cooling down.
Location of the Radiator
• The radiator should be positioned where you most need the warmth.
• It is recommended to place the radiator underneath the coldest window in the room as this helps to increase
the convective movement of the heat.
• Do not locate the radiator underneath a xed power point.
• Always ensure that the radiator is placed at least 50cm away from furniture, curtains, walls etc.
Plugging in the Radiator
Before plugging the radiator into the mains, ensure that your supply voltage is the same as what is shown on the
rating plate of the radiator. Try to avoid contact between the radiator and clothes, household linen, furniture,
inammable material and the power socket.
Turning on and Using the Radiator
1. Turn on the radiator using the switch (B) and the indicator light will come on.
2. Turn the thermostat dial (C) to the MAX setting.
3. When the desired room temperature has been reached, turn back the thermostat dial until the indicator lamp
goes out.
Cleaning and Maintenance
Before attempting any cleaning or maintenance on the radiator, allow it to cool completely and ensure that the plug
is removed from the socket.
To clean the radiator, use a soft damp cloth without any abrasives or detergents on. If the radiator is not going to be
used for a long period of time, wrap the cable around the cable tidy and store the radiator in a dry place. Storing the
radiator in a damp environment could cause the radiator to rust and/or will effect the electronics in the radiator
which is not covered by your guarantee.
This product must be earthed. Fit a 13A BS1362 fuse in a 13A BS1363 plug. Fit the
green/yellow wire to E, the blue wire to N and the brown wire to L. Fit the cord grip.
If in doubt, call an electrician. Don’t use a non-rewireable plug unless the fuse cover
is tted. If you remove the plug, dispose of it.
